codeforces628a
阿新 • • 發佈:2018-12-24
題意是這個,給你一個n個人,然後一次比賽喝幾瓶水,還有比賽人員用幾條毛巾。
然後比賽這麼回事,一次比賽,分成兩份,贏的人晉級,還有就是剩下的人,直接晉級。一次比賽中,裁判和比賽人員一人喝那個幾瓶水。。。。
#include<cstdio>
#include<algorithm>
#include<cstring>
using namespace std;
int main()
{
int b , n , p , ans = 0;
scanf("%d %d %d",&n , &b , &p);
int sum = n;
while (n != 1){
ans += ( n / 2);
if(n % 2 == 1){
n = (n + 1) / 2;
}
else n /= 2;
// printf("n = %d\n",n);
}
// printf("*%d",ans);
printf("%d %d",ans * (b * 2 + 1) , sum * p);
return 0;
}